Average Exercise Physiologists Salary in Illinois

Exercise Physiologists in Illinois earn an average annual salary of $65,410, surpassing the national average of $58,550. This higher compensation in Illinois can be attributed to a combination of factors, including the state's specific healthcare demands and the overall economic landscape influencing specialized roles.

Executive Summary

  • Average Salary: $65,410 per year.
  •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 17.3% over the last 5 years.
  •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$84,210.
  • Outlook: With a local workforce of 310 Exercise Physiologists and a Location Quotient of 0.98, the job market in Illinois indicates a stable, albeit slightly below national average, concentration of these professionals. The number of jobs per 1,000 workers at 0.052 suggests a consistent demand that aligns closely with national trends, pointing to a robust but not overly saturated employment environment.

The average annual salary of $65,410 in Illinois presents a favorable financial outlook when considering the local Cost of Living Index of 91.8. This index, which is below the national average of 100, means that the purchasing power of an Exercise Physiologist's salary in Illinois is likely higher than the national average, allowing for a comfortable standard of living.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 310 employees in the Illinois area with a job density of 0.052 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
